100 1 $aGoble, Paul.
245 10 $aBuffalo woman /$cstory and illustrations by Paul Goble.
260 $aScarsdale, N.Y. :$bBradbury Press,$cc1984.
300 $a[32] p. :$bcol. ill. ;$c25 x 25 cm.
504 $aBibliography: T.p. verso.
520 $aA young hunter marries a female buffalo in the form of a beautiful maiden, but when his people reject her he must pass several tests before being allowed to join the buffalo nation.
